Analysis
In 2024, rye — gross production value in South Africa stood at 327 1000 USD.
The figure is up 10.1% on the previous year and down 15.9% over ten years.
Over the whole period, rye — gross production value in South Africa peaked at 745 1000 USD in 1991 and was at its lowest, 30 1000 USD, in 2003.
That places South Africa 47th out of 58 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 34 years of available data.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 459.22 1000 USD | 328 1000 USD | 745 1000 USD | 9 |
| 2000s | 249.7 1000 USD | 30 1000 USD | 539 1000 USD | 10 |
| 2010s | 395 1000 USD | 311 1000 USD | 493 1000 USD | 10 |
| 2020s | 331.4 1000 USD | 297 1000 USD | 365 1000 USD | 5 |

About this data
The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
